Focused: Thank you! 2.5 and a cutting pad cut up the ugly buffer swirls and deep swirls from poor washing skills. It left a deeper/wetter finish with minor micro-marring (buffer swirls). It was imperative to follow up with a finer polish to leave the shine at it's peak.

Thanks, just trying to figure out how long this'll take me, so I know what to charge....Is $150 too much for a weekend/summer detailer to charge for the following package?

Wash (4*)
Clay (sonus)
Wheel/Tire, then dressing (Eimann Fabrik/4*)
Polish (FP2)
Glaze (FTG)
Sealant (FMJ by hand)
Glass treated (invisible glass, then RainX)
Polishing of all metal (Luster/Wenol)
Plastic/Trim treated

Vacuum
Interior Cleaned
Carpet Shampood (Oxy)
Upholstery Cleaned
Vinyl/Plastic Protected/Dressed

So basically a full exterior/interior detail? I would charge extra for Swirls, oxidation (PowerGloss), Leather Cleaning and Conditioning, etc.
